The Mapleton housing market is somewhat competitive. The median sale price of a home in Mapleton was $725K last month, down 5.2% since last year. The median sale price per square foot in Mapleton is $202, up 5.2% since last year.
What is the housing market like in Mapleton today?
In February 2025, Mapleton home prices were down 5.2% compared to last year, selling for a median price of $725K. On average, homes in Mapleton sell after 101 days on the market compared to 97 days last year. There were 11 homes sold in February this year, down from 12 last year.

Climate's impact on Mapleton housing
Learn about natural hazards and environmental risks, such as floods, fires, wind, and heat that
could impact homes in Mapleton.
Flood Factor - Moderate
32% of properties are at risk of severe flooding over the next 30 years
Flood Factor
Mapleton has a moderate risk of flooding. 1,000 properties in Mapleton are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 32% of all properties in Mapleton.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.
100% of properties are at risk of wildfire over the next 30 years
Fire Factor
Mapleton has a severe risk of wildfire. There are 5,847 properties in Mapleton that have some risk of being affected by wildfire over the next 30 years. This represents 100% of all properties in Mapleton.
